0


0

Twitterユーザーベースでアプリケーションを構築できますか?

それはただ別のオープンIDなのか、それとももっと何かなのか?

twitpicといくつかのMUDタイプのゲーム14mafia.comを使っているとき、私はtwitterログインを使っていることに気づきました(あなたの代わりにツイートします)

彼らが私のログイン/パスワードを使っているのであれば、かなりクレイジーです。

とにかく、私たちがopenidのように彼らのメンバーシップを再利用することができるかどうか私に言うことをexpereinceを持つ開発者が欲しいだけですか?

3 Answer


2


_ Twitterユーザーベースでアプリケーションを構築できますか? _

Twitter APIについてはhttp://apiwiki.twitter.com/に説明があります。

_ それはただ別のオープンIDなのか、それとももっと何かなのか? _

TwitterはOpenIDの利用者でも提供者でもありません。

_ _ twitpicといくつかのMUDタイプのゲーム14mafia.comを使っているとき、私はtwitterログインを使っていることに気づきました(あなたの代わりにツイートします)

彼らが私のログイン/パスワードを使っているのであれば、かなりクレイジーです。 _ _

ひどいセキュリティ パスワードを第三者のサイトに公開しないでください。 ある人は単にパスワードアンチパターンを使用し、他の人はあなたが望まない目的のためにあなたの資格情報を盗むでしょう。

今日のTwitterはOAuthをサポートしています。 サイトがあなたのTwitterプロフィールで何かをしたいのなら、それを使うべきです。

_ とにかく、私たちがopenidのように彼らのメンバーシップを再利用することができるかどうか私に言うことをexpereinceを持つ開発者が欲しいだけですか? _

いいえ、できません。


1


Twitterでは、そのAPIで OAuthと単純なユーザー名/パスワード認証の両方を提供しています。 もともと彼らは 基本認証 APIしか持っていなかったので、それを使って初期のアプリの多くが作られました。 その後、彼らはOAuthのサポートを追加しましたが、基本認証を使用する方が簡単だったので、多くのTwitterクライアントやアプリがまだそれを使用しています。

単純認証を使用している場合はパスワードが要求されるため、アプリケーションが使用しているものを特定できます。 その場合あなたはそれを信頼しなければなりません。 それはセキュリティが低いということです。


0


彼らは Twitter APIを使用していると思います。